Hi Yoichi,
I first used the COBALT_LED_PORT address but it did not work for a reason I
ignore. If I use the COBALT_LED_BASE as defined, which is taken from the CoLo
code, it works fine.
Do know you what could explain this difference ? Can you test it on your
boxes ?

> > This patch adds support for controlling the front LED on Cobalt Server.
> > It has been tested on Qube 2 with either no default trigger, or the
> > IDE-activity trigger. Both work fine. Please comment and test !

> > #define COBALT_LED_PORT (*(volatile unsigned char *)
> > CKSEG1ADDR(0x1c000000))
> > +#define COBALT_LED_BASE 0xbc000000
>
> You don't need COBALT_LED_BASE.
> Because COBALT_LED_PORT is already defined.
